Berlin MP Shines in Muscat Stage of GCAT

Muscat (OMN), March 2025
Set against the breathtaking backdrop of the Omani coastline and the Hajar Mountains, the third stage of the Global Champions Arabians Tour in Muscat from 6-8 March delivered an extraordinary showcase of Arabian horse breeding. With Tour regulars such as D Borkan and Shahbrys HVP returning to the ring alongside some exceptional horses from Omani breeders, the event welcomed esteemed guests and passionate fans from around the world for three days of thrilling competition and cultural celebration.

AJ Sindala secured the first gold of Muscat for Ajman Stud, United Arab Emirates, with eight votes for gold. The refined grey filly, expertly handled by Glenn Schoukens, won her qualifying class with a score of 92 points. Dubai Arabian Horse Stud clinched the silver title with D Neeran, who placed third in her qualifying class with a score of 91.93 points, whilst the winner of Section A, Athbah, secured bronze for Qatar’s Al Thamer Stud.
Yearling colt Tashaar Al Shaqab took gold for Al Shaqab Stud of Qatar, following a class win in the qualifier with 91.79 points. Sharar Almanhal took silver for Qatar’s SK Arabians following a gold title at GCAT Ajman in January and silver in Muscat. AJ Nayd followed in the bronze position for Ajman Stud, UAE.
Shahalel Al Shaqab continued her unbeatable winning streak, taking another gold for Al Shaqab Stud, Qatar, and handler Arnauld Mertens. Shahbrys HVP followed in silver for Ajmal Stud of Saudi Arabia, whilst AJ Sajeel took bronze for the UAE’s Ajman Stud.
Last year’s leading male, D Borkan, returns to winning form, taking gold for Dubai Arabian Horse Stud following a class win on 92.57 points, with unanimous 20s across the board for type and head & neck. Albidayer Stud, also from the UAE, took silver with Azaam Al Amal, while D Hayel took bronze for Qatar’s Al Thamer Stud.
Former World Champion D Shihana delivered a breathtaking performance to take gold in the Senior Mare Championships for owners Dubai Arabian Horse Stud of the UAE. Ajman Stud took the silver and bronze with Al Aryam Banafsaj and RK Sadeem respectively.
The grand finale of the event saw Berlin MP crowned the Gold Senior Stallion Champion for Hleetan Stud, Qatar, after an electrifying performance. Almirqab Stud of Qatar’s Ammar stood silver, while Oman’s Royal Cavalry took bronze with Shareem RC.
As the Tour moves forward to its next destination, Shahalel Al Shaqabretains her position at the top of the female rankings with 60 points, while Sharar Almanhal takes the lead in the male standings with 54 points. Last year’s Best Handler Paolo Capecci now leads the overall handler rankings with 153 points, following a dominant performance in Muscat.

YEARLING FILLIES CHAMPIONSHIP – GOLD: AJ SINDALA (Gaith Al Zobair x AJ Sajwa); Owner and Breeder Ajman Stud – HH Sh Ammar Bin Humaid Al Nuaimi. SILVER: D NEERAN (Exxalt x D Shihanah); Owner and Breeder Dubai Arabian Horse Stud. BRONZE: ATHBAH (Ghaith Al Zobair x Shamah Al Athba); Owner Al Thamer Stud, Breeder Al Athba Stud.
YEARLING COLTS CHAMPIONSHIP – GOLD: TASHAAR AL SHAQAB (Excalibur EA x Mazaya Al Shaqab); Owner and Breeder Al Shaqab (Member of Q.F.). SILVER: SHARAR ALMANHAL (M Munther x Shams Almanhal); Owner SK Arabians, Breeder Fahed Salem Alzaabi. BRONZE: AJ NAYD (AJ Mardan x HDM Bella Ciao); Owner and Breeder Ajman Stud – HH Sh Ammar Bin Humaid Al Nuaimi.
JUNIOR FILLIES CHAMPIONSHIP – GOLD: SHAHALEL AL SHAQAB (NA-Mousa Al Shahania x Siwar Al Shaqab); Owner and Breeder Al Shaqab (Member of Q.F.). SILVER: SHAHBRYS HVP (Royal Asad x Rebecca HVP); Owner Turki Alothman, Breeder Agropecuária Vila dos Pinheiros. BRONZE: AJ SAJEEL (Shanghai EA x AJ Sephora); Owner and Breeder Ajman Stud – HH Sh Ammar Bin Humaid Al Nuaimi.
JUNIOR COLTS CHAMPIONSHIP – GOLD: D BORKAN (FA El Rasheem x D Ajayeb); Owner and Breeder Dubai Arabian Horse Stud. SILVER: AZZAAM AL AMAL (EL Galal Baahir x Arabesca Scarlet Moon); Owner Sheikh Mohammed Saoud Sultan S Alqassimi, Breeder Al Amal Arabians. BRONZE: D HAYEL (D Shakhat x D Jawaher); Owner Al Thamer Stud, Breeder Dubai Arabian Horse Stud.
SENIOR MARES CHAMPIONSHIP – GOLD: D SHIHANAH (FA El Rasheem x D Shahla); Owner and Breeder Dubai Arabian Horse Stud. SILVER: AL ARYAM BANAFSAJ (Dominic M x Al Aryam Basma); Owner Ajman Stud – HH Sh Ammar Bin Humaid Al Nuaimi, Breeder Al Aryam Arabians. BRONZE: RK SADEEM (Magid Moniscione x BV Especially Stivana); Owner Ajman Stud – HH Sh Ammar Bin Humaid Al Nuaimi, Breeder Rashed Khaled Alanzan (Shazin Stud).
SENIOR STALLIONS CHAMPIONSHIP – GOLD: BERLIN MP (S.M.A. Magic One x Baraka MP); Owner Hleetan Qatar Stud, Breeder Mindy Peters. SILVER: AMMAR (RFI Farid x Adiya); Owner Almirqab Farm, Breeder Al Juman Stud. BRONZE: SHAREEM RC (FA El Rasheem x EKS Shakira); Owner and Breeder Royal Cavalry Oman. |
